Chelsea confirm signing of highly rated Wales goalkeeper Eddie Beach

Chelsea have signed goalkeeper Eddie Beach.

The 18-year-old arrives from Southampton and will join the academy for an undisclosed fee.

Beach is highly rated and Chelsea reportedly beat a number of interested clubs to the teenager’s signature.

He has represented Wales at Under-19 level, have made 20 appearances in all competitions for Southampton U18s last season as they came top of the Premier League South last season. The young Saints side then lost to Manchester City in the National Final.

Beach was even rewarded with an outing for the U23s.

Jim Fraser, Chelsea’s assistant head of youth development and head of youth recruitment, told the club’s official website: "We are very pleased to bring Eddie to the club.

“He is a talented goalkeeper with good potential and will join our development squad for the coming season."

Beach is not expected to be the only new goalkeeper through the door at Chelsea this summer, with the club also keen on Chicago Fire's Gabriel Slonina.
